Folk-fusion collective debut their new album in Dalston

  • from £13.50 | The Jago 440 Kingsland Road London, England, E8 4AA United Kingdom (map)

the ttn team recommends…

Award-winning folk-fusion collective Kabantu perform their new album freehand live for the first time in legendary Dalston music venue The Jago.

Aiming to celebrate the space where different cultures meet, the collective's 2018 debut album "Of the People" won critical acclaim from the Guardian, Songlines Magazine and FRoots.

Combining classical and folk influences from around the world into amazing compositions, we can’t wait to hear what’s on the new album at this official launch party.
